I suggest you don't buy this switch. I bought the same model of this tp-link switch. It worked when you just setup and you could have iptv and internet split before router.
I was able to use any router to pppoe and connected to internet.
But after a few days, the switch seemed getting saturated and the iptv signal just gone. You will need to restart your switch to get the signal back. I don't think the unit that i bought was faulty. It is because i bought 2 units at the same time, sealed box. They got the same problem
I refer to the same way of settings and changed to similar switch Netgear GS105Ev2. It works until now. Never see any problem.

I would like to share my bad review of netgear gs105ev2. Firstly, it requires a stupid utility that only works on windows to configure. Second, the switch crashes at random times a week or multicast storm (iptv) or when i enter too many vlans. I ditched it for a tplink tl-sg105e which had a nicer interface and didnt crash.
Oh and btw i rate limit my iptv port to 100base-t, 30mbps qos it helps
And btw mine was only rm105 (compared to netgear is cheap)
